Description
This little module allows you to change your character's alignment to one of the nine types by speaking to the corresponding creature. PLEASE NOTE: Personally I consider changing a char's alignment so freely cheating. I designed this module only for testing purposes (trying out some character concepts like an evil fallen Paladin/Sorcerer - no sense in runnning around in some module and killing countless commoners, right?). You might also use this module to restore your char's alignment if a user mod has screwed your char (like applying 50 points towards evil for bashing a door or something like that). Again: Use at your own risk - and don't use it to cheat. Feel free to let me know what you think about it...
